Fig. 5 and the remaining views of the drawing show structures adapted to be manufactured from sheet metal instead of vfrom bent wire.v The blank shown in Fig.l 5 includes a substantially circular body portion 3E! having a lug 32 at one side and a neck portion 34 extending from the opposite side and connecting the body portion 30 with therhandle 36. As seen in Fig. 8, the part 32 is bent downwardly at right angles to the circular body portion 3U and the part 34 also is bent downwardly while the handle 36 extends horizontally in a plane yparallel to that ofA the body 38. The right angle bend at 38 forming the junction between the part 34 and the handle 36 provides the iulcrum which is to rest upon the bottle cap, and the lug 32 is formed with a terminal nib 4i! adapted to engage under the iiange o f the bottle cap which is to be removed. The substantially circular body portion 3U provides a flat upwardly exposed surface which may be directly decorated or printed so as to serve as a display surface for advertising matter and it also may perform the mechanical function of a bearing area for the thumb in the same manner as the cap 24 serves in the bent wire structure. However, if desired, a conventional crown `cap 44 may be crimped onto the body portion 30 of this opener; aportion of lsuch a cap is shown thus positioned in Figs. 6 and 7 and said cap 44 is shown in section in Figs. 8 and 9.
Figures 10 and 11 show another formV of opener made from sheet metal in which thebody portion 5G has a connected arm 52 extending downwardly therefrom at one side with a horizontally extending handle portion 54 bent laterally therefrom. A lug 56 extends downwardly below the plane of the handle 54 and is formed with a nib 58 at its lower end adapted to engage under the edge of a bottle cap. The stock for the lug 56 is obtained by cutting it from the area of the body 50 and the portion 52, leaving an opening 51 in the body, as seen in Fig. 11, and, in eiect, bifurcating the part 52 throughoutits length.. At the opposite side of the body 50 a depending lug 60 serves as the fulcrum to bear on the top surface of a bottle cap when the nib 58 is'engaged under the ange of the cap at the opposite side for prying it loose from the bottle neck. In this form of the device, as'in the others, a standard bottle cap 64 may be crimped over the body 5U to give the device an ornamental appearance and to provide an upwardly exposed fiat g surface which may be used for the displayfof advertising matter if desired. It will be evident, however, that if the cap 64 is omitted. the top surface of 4 the body 56 may be decorated in any desired manner and may carry an advertising message. In all forms of the invention herein shown it will be noted that the tool as a whole is relatively flat, the working parts being confined to the vicinity of the plane of the handle which represents the main bulk of the article; it can be conveniently stored with otherutensils in a drawer or can be hung on a hook when not in use. While there are shown and described herein certain structures embodying the invention and illustrative thereof, it is to be understood that the invention is not limited thereto or thereby but'embraces all modifications, variations and .equivalents coming within the scope of the appended claims.
